Nørrebro
Nørrebro, Copenhagen's old working-class neighbourhood, is now a hip, lively and multicultural area, where you can experience the best of modern Copenhagen.

Nørrebro is a lively and colourful neighbourhood where people from all classes and various ethnic backgrounds live side by side. This means that during your city break to Nørrebro, you will get to experience a great variety of shops, cafés and restaurants only a few minutes away from central Copenhagen.

The district gets its name from Nørrebrogade, a road that used to lead in and out of Copenhagen's Northern Gate. The Copenhagen ramparts were opened in the mid-1800s, and this allowed industry to develop in the area. Nørrebro's massive transformation from working-class neighbourhood to hip quarter has come as a result of redevelopment in recent years, bringing young people, students and artists to the area.

Take a walk and visit the Assistens Kirkegården (Assistens Cemetery), where famous Danes such as Hans Christian Andersen and Søren Kierkegaard are buried, and keep walking towards Nørrebro Bryghus (Nørrebro Brewery), Denmark's first carbon-neutral brewery, where you can enjoy wonderful food and exceptional beer. In the evening, enjoy comedy performances at Nørrebro Theatre. Don't forget to go shopping two great places are Elmegade and Jægersborggade.

Nørrebro is the most populated district of Copenhagen, so get ready for a lively cityscape with lots of people and plenty of things to see and do. And that's the Nørrebro experience in a nutshell: walking around the streets and experiencing everyday life, visiting the halal butcher or the greengrocer and sitting down in one of the many lovely cafés or restaurants.

When travelling around Nørrebro, it's a good idea to walk so that you can take in everything. Nørrebro is also well-connected with the rest of Copenhagen by both bus and train. The easiest way to travel is to use the city buses, which go from the main station (Hovedbanegården), and the metro and bus both travel directly to Copenhagen Airport.

A holiday to Nørrebro gives you the opportunity to experience the best of multicultural Denmark, and you will also have easy access to experience all of Copenhagen's other attractions.
